What is an AccuQuilt Studio/AccuCut GrandeMark Machine?
I have the GrandeMark/Studio and Go! Baby that I won (pictured above). AccuQuilt has 3 machines to chose from the Go! Baby, Go!, and the Studio fabric cutters. You can go here to see which machine is right for you.
The machine does the cutting for me. All I have to do is place my fabric on the die, place the plastic sheet over the die, and then roll the die through. It can cut anything a scissors can–faster and easier. Plus my fingers don’t get tired!!! I make rag quilts and LOVE this machine for their rag dies!!!

What are pre-fringed squares/rectangles?
Don’t like cutting all those fringe once your rag quilt is put together? Then let me do it for you. My squares and rectangles have the fringe already cut into the shape. The fringe measurement is 3/4″. It will give your rag quilt a full bloom.
